    Do not do business here. This business sold me a Waterower machine, natural color, for $1,499 plus…read moretax ($89). They said it was commercial grade and worth $3,000. I looked it up online and the same model, new, costs $1,199. I then called the manufacturer and they looked up the serial number. The unit I purchased was built in 2017. I called the store and asked what they would do to remedy the situation. Because they had already paid commissions to the sales rep (I bought this 2 days ago), they were willing to take it back for a full in-store credit or give me back $300. I don't want a credit because I don't trust the store, and the $300 refund makes it equivalent to the price of a new unit, yet it's six years old and has a one warranty from the store. The manufacturer said they are not an authorized reseller so I'm not sure how they would initiate a warranty repair. I called back the next day to facilitate then refund and asked if perhaps I could just pay them the amount they paid the sales rep in commission and then get a full refund. The owner got very upset with my line of questioning and eventually hung up. No refund. I have reported them to the Better Business Bureau. This is a dishonest company that is more worried more about having to take back commission from their sales rep than they are making the customer happy. Do not do business here.
